Warning Signs You Need Standing Water Extraction
Catching these signs early can save you a lot of money and prevent bigger problems down the line. You might be wondering if you need Standing Water Extraction, but these warning signs are clear indicators that you need to act fast.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of standing water or moisture issues in your home.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s time to call us.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or standing water.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.
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ings
Water stains on walls or ceilings can be a sign of a more significant issue. If you notice any water marks or stains, it’s time to call us.
Unusual Mold or Mildew Growth
Mold and mildew can grow quickly in damp environments. If you notice any unusual growth,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.
Increased Humidity or Moisture
High humidity or moisture levels can be a sign of standing water or moisture issues. If you notice any changes in your home’s humidity or moisture levels, it’s time to call us.
Water Damage or Leaks Under Appliances
Water damage or leaks under appliances can be a sign of a more significant issue. If you notice any water damage or leaks,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Standing Water Extraction Cost in Hesperia, CA
The cost of Standing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Hesperia, CA. These estimates are based on typical scenarios and may not reflect your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ions. |
| Sanitizing and Cleaning |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ials affected, and level of contamination. |
| Restoration and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ials affected, and level of damage. |
| Dehumidification and Ventilation |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area and level of moisture. |
| Disinfection and Odor Removal | $50 – $200 | Size of affected area and level of contamination. |
| Inspection and Assessment | $100 – $300 | Size of affected area and level of damage. |

Common Questions About Standing Water Extraction
Q: What causes standing water in my home?
A: Standing water can be caused by a variety of factors, including leaks, floods, appliance malfunctions, and poor drainage. Our team can help you identify the source of the water and provide recommendations for preventing future issues.
Q: How long does Standing Water Extraction take?
A: The length of time it takes to complete Standing Water Extraction dep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will work with you to create a customized plan and provide regular updates on the progress.
Q: Is Standing Water Extraction covered by insurance?
A: Yes, Standing Water Extraction is often covered by insurance, but the specifics depend on your policy and the circumstances of the damage. Our team can help you navigate the claims process and ensure that you receive the coverage you deserve.
